Main Office
1931 N Meacham Rd, Schaumburg, IL 60173-4364
(847) 330-9095
We Are Here
Physicians & Surgeons in Schaumburg, Illinois
Main Office
1931 N Meacham Rd, Schaumburg, IL 60173-4364
(847) 330-9095
Copyright © 2025 WebForCompany.com. All rights reserved.